We are going to the city of Tampere in Finland. Where the home team, who plays in the Nokia Arena, welcomes their guests, the Pelicans from the city of Lahti.
The season in Finland's top league, with the catchy name Liiga, is coming to an end. Ilves has settled into a good position before the end, leading the table with 4 points. Ilves has 2 games left to play, while the team in second place has 3 games left.
The Pelicans, on the other hand, are at the opposite end of the table, down in 15th place, and in danger of relegation. They are 3 points away from safety, with 3 games left to play. It smells like a home win, right?
Ilves – Must find form before the playoffs.
Ilves, who lead the table, have simply been in poor form recently. The team, which is one of the two big ones in a historical context in Finland, finally has the opportunity to win something again. Their last title was back in 1985. They have slowly but surely built themselves up again in recent years, and have 3rd, 2nd and 2nd place in the last three seasons. Which indicates a stable team that is aiming for the top. If they are to be able to crown this season with a league title, matches like this one just have to be won. But as I said, the form has been lacking, and the team needs to go up a few notches before we get to the playoffs.
We believe that the team will use this match to improve themselves and get a good experience. They can secure the title already at home this round with the right results. The team scores okay goals, but concedes the least of all. The team is also the home team in the league that has taken the most points on their own ice. That gives them confidence going into this one. They may lack the very best point-getters, but are very stable in all ranks. That is probably also the great strength this team has. They are well balanced, and all ranks can create something.
We think that should be enough in this match.
Pelicans – A team in disintegration?
After the previous two seasons that ended in 4th and 3rd place, one might well ask what has happened to this Pelicans team?
They have been a team you don't recognize, you can safely say. They are now in danger of having to go down a division. There are still games left to save their place. But then they have to win some games, and we think this one might be tough against a team at the top of the table, who also have to win.
The team scores a little less than they concede, and that is never a good sign. But it should also be said that this team has lost many regular matches, and in that sense has not been lucky. But how many times have we seen this. When a team that is really too good to be relegated ends up in this position, the pressure increases. The games do not become easier to win.
The team has only won 1 of the last 5 games, and that doesn't bode well for a team that desperately needs points. There is also a lack of depth in the team, and that could be decisive against a team that has several good ranks. We think they will have a tough time in this one.
